Chesterfield offers a blend of natural beauty and intriguing history. Start your exploration of this area at the Madame Sherri Forest. This place is like stepping into a fairy tale with its lush greenery and lovely trails. The forest is famous for the ruins of the Madame Sherri House—a stone staircase that seemingly leads to nowhere, earning it the nickname “the staircase to heaven.” It's the remnant of a once-grand castle-like summer house built by the eccentric Madame Antoinette Sherri, a Parisian costume designer known for her lavish parties in the 1920s. The site is both mysterious and picturesque, offering a unique glimpse into the past wrapped in nature's embrace. Not too far from there, Chesterfield Gorge Natural Area is another gem you won't want to miss. It's a lovely spot for a casual hike or a peaceful picnic, featuring a series of trails that meander through a stunning gorge carved out by glacial activity eons ago.
